      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hello. Print Studio Pro is not a stand alone program, it is a plug-in. You access it by using Canon DPP and chosing Plug-in Printing.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If you go to the Print Studio Pro folder under Canon Utilities you can install the plug-in in Lightroom and/or Photoshop.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
